Forms of Daycares:
There are various types of daycares offered, each catering to different needs and preferences. Some traditional kinds of daycares feature:

  1. In-home Daycares: they're typically operate by an individual or family in their own home. They feature a far more intimate setting with less child-to-caregiver ratio.


  1. Childcare Centers: they are larger facilities that appeal to a more substantial range kids. They might provide more structured programs and activities.


  1. Preschools: These are just like childcare centers but focus more about very early knowledge and college ability.


  1. Montessori Schools: These schools follow the Montessori way of knowledge, which emphasizes independency, self-directed discovering, and hands-on activities.


Providers Offered:
Daycares provide a variety of solutions to generally meet the needs of working moms and dads and offer a nurturing environment for children. Some traditional services offered by daycares feature:

  1. Full-day attention: Many daycares offer full-day take care of working moms and dads, offering attention from morning until night.


  1. Part-time care: Some daycares provide part-time care choices for moms and dads whom just need care for several days weekly or several hours each and every day.


  1. Early education: numerous daycares provide very early training programs that give attention to school ability and intellectual development.


  1. Nutritious meals: Some daycares offer naturally healthy dishes and treats for kids each day.

Expenses:
The price of daycare can vary with respect to the variety of daycare, place, and solutions supplied. Some aspects that will impact the cost of daycare include:

  1. Style of daycare: In-home daycares might be inexpensive than childcare facilities or preschools.


  1. Location: Daycares in towns or high-cost-of-living areas may have higher fees.


  1. Providers offered: Daycares that offer additional solutions, like early education programs or dishes, could have higher costs.


  1. Subsidies: Some families might be entitled to subsidies or monetary assist with help protect the price of daycare.
